Agricultural Chemicals:
The use of Fatty Methyl Ester Sulfonate in agricultural chemicals is becoming increasingly prominent, as it serves as an effective surfactant in pesticide formulations. FMES enhances the spreading and adherence of agrochemicals, improving their performance and efficacy. The rising trend of precision agriculture, combined with the growing emphasis on sustainable farming practices, is propelling the demand for eco-friendly surfactants like FMES in agricultural applications. Additionally, the shift towards organic farming is expected to further boost the market for FMES, as farmers seek biodegradable alternatives that pose less risk to the environment. This segment signifies a vital growth avenue for the FMES market, contributing to its overall expansion.
Others:
The "Others" segment encapsulates various niche applications where Fatty Methyl Ester Sulfonate is utilized, including its use in textile manufacturing, oil recovery, and coatings. In textiles, FMES acts as a wetting agent and dispersant, improving dye penetration and color vibrancy. In oil recovery, it is employed to enhance oil extraction processes by reducing interfacial tension between the oil and water phases. The coatings segment benefits from the emulsifying and stabilizing properties of FMES, which are essential for producing consistent and high-quality finishes. As these niche applications continue to develop, the demand for FMES in these areas is expected to contribute to the overall market growth.

Palm Oil Fatty Methyl Ester Sulfonate:
Palm oil-based Fatty Methyl Ester Sulfonate is another widely utilized ingredient type in the market, primarily due to its availability and cost-effectiveness. It is used in various applications, including household cleaning products and industrial cleaning agents. However, the growing concerns around palm oil production and its impact on deforestation and biodiversity are prompting manufacturers to seek sustainable sourcing options. Companies that prioritize sustainable palm oil certifications are likely to gain favor among consumers, as the demand for responsible sourcing increases in the market.

Threats
Despite the positive growth trajectory of the Fatty Methyl Ester Sulfonate market, certain threats could potentially hinder its progress. One of the primary threats is the volatility of raw material prices, particularly with ingredients derived from vegetable oils, which can be influenced by changing agricultural conditions, global supply chain disruptions, and fluctuating demand. This volatility can affect the cost structure for manufacturers, ultimately impacting pricing strategies and profit margins. As companies strive to maintain competitive pricing while adhering to sustainable sourcing practices, managing these cost fluctuations will be crucial for sustaining growth in the FMES market.
Additionally, the presence of alternative surfactants in the market poses a significant challenge. Synthetic surfactants and other biodegradable alternatives are continually evolving and may offer comparable performance at lower costs. This competition could potentially divert consumer interest away from FMES-based products, especially if they are perceived as more expensive or less effective. To mitigate this threat, manufacturers must invest in research and development to consistently improve the performance characteristics of FMES and communicate the unique benefits of using eco-friendly surfactants to consumers.
